    Climb Global Solutions

    CLMB is one of the several suitable candidates that passed through the screen. Here are the key reasons why it could be a profitable bet for “trend” investors.

    A solid price increase over a period of 12 weeks reflects investors’ continued willingness to pay more for the potential upside in a stock. CLMB is quite a good fit in this regard, gaining 60.9% over this period.

    However, it’s not enough to look at the price change for around three months, as it doesn’t reflect any trend reversal that might have happened in a shorter time frame. It’s important for a potential winner to maintain the price trend. A price increase of 7.5% over the past four weeks ensures that the trend is still in place for the stock of this computer software reseller.

    Moreover, CLMB is currently trading at 92% of its 52-week High-Low Range, hinting that it can be on the verge of a breakout.

    Looking at the fundamentals, the stock currently carries a Zacks Rank #1 (Strong Buy), which means it is in the top 5% of more than the 4,000 stocks that we rank based on trends in earnings estimate revisions and EPS surprises — the key factors that impact a stock’s near-term price movements.

    The Zacks Rank stock-rating system, which uses four factors related to earnings estimates to classify stocks into five groups, ranging from Zacks Rank #1 (Strong Buy) to Zacks Rank #5 (Strong Sell), has an impressive externally-audited track record, with Zacks Rank #1 stocks generating an average annual return of +25% since 1988.

    Another factor that confirms the company’s fundamental strength is its Average Broker Recommendation of #1 (Strong Buy). This indicates that the brokerage community is highly optimistic about the stock’s near-term price performance.

    So, the price trend in CLMB may not reverse anytime soon.
